Analysis
Jordan recorded 0 1000 USD for others (adjustment) — wood chips and particles — import value in 2018.
The figure is down 100.0% on the previous year.
Over the whole period, others (adjustment) — wood chips and particles — import value in Jordan peaked at 16 1000 USD in 2016 and was at its lowest, -20 1000 USD, in 2015.
Jordan ranks 55th of 136 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
